If you want to add a single file, click on it and then click on the Add button. If you want to add 2 or more files from the same directory hold down the CTRL key and click on all the files you want to add, then click on the Add button. ![]() Now the new file / class has been added to the file. To compile a class that is part of a program you can either click the Compile button on the left side of the window or right click on the icon of the class and select the Compile option from the pop up menu.
